I have a dual tds hm digital meter and I have the "in" sensor after the ro membrane, and the "out" sensor in the product water line after the di resin. My question is, why is the in sensor reading 001ppm and the out sensor reads 007ppm? How can the tap water which is 260ppm be filtered down to 001 and then after it goes through the di resin have more tds than before it went into it?:confused::confused::confused:
 
Yeah replace it. There is a color changing media so it is easier to tell when to replace it. But with a TDS meter that will tell you and be a better indicator. When DI water TDS goes up past what it is going in at, time to change it. On a side not I do not have a DI my TDS out of the RO is 8ppm, tap is 475-500ppm. I have no issues with 8 TDS water.
